/external/v8/src/interpreter/ |
D | interpreter-assembler.cc | 112 offset = IntPtrSub(BytecodeOffset(), IntPtrConstant(1)); in SaveBytecodeOffset() 296 return IntPtrSub(reg_list.base_reg_location(), offset); in RegisterLocationInRegisterList() 1300 Node* next_offset = backward ? IntPtrSub(BytecodeOffset(), delta) in Advance() 1634 Node* reg_index = IntPtrSub(reg_base, index); in ExportParametersAndRegisterFile() 1660 IntPtrSub(IntPtrConstant(Register(0).ToOperand()), index); in ExportParametersAndRegisterFile() 1704 IntPtrSub(IntPtrConstant(Register(0).ToOperand()), index); in ImportRegisterFile()
|
D | interpreter-generator.cc | 687 Node* export_index = IntPtrSub(cell_index, IntPtrConstant(1)); in IGNITION_HANDLER() 698 Node* import_index = IntPtrSub(IntPtrConstant(-1), cell_index); in IGNITION_HANDLER() 729 Node* export_index = IntPtrSub(cell_index, IntPtrConstant(1)); in IGNITION_HANDLER() 2303 Node* case_value = IntPtrSub(SmiUntag(acc), case_value_base); in IGNITION_HANDLER()
|
/external/v8/src/builtins/ |
D | builtins-string-gen.cc | 836 IntPtrSub(subject_length, start_position)), in StringIndexOf() 873 IntPtrSub(subject_length, start_position))); in StringIndexOf() 899 Node* const search_length = IntPtrSub(subject_length, start_position); in StringIndexOf() 911 IntPtrAdd(IntPtrSub(result_address, string_addr), start_position); in StringIndexOf() 2054 IntPtrSub(string_length, var_start.value()); in TF_BUILTIN() 2081 var_result_length = IntPtrSub(string_length, var_start.value()); in TF_BUILTIN() 2255 TVARIABLE(IntPtrT, var_end, IntPtrSub(string_length, IntPtrConstant(1))); in Generate()
|
D | builtins-collections-gen.cc | 1286 WordAnd(hash, IntPtrSub(number_of_buckets, IntPtrConstant(1))); in StoreOrderedHashMapNewEntry() 1454 WordAnd(hash, IntPtrSub(number_of_buckets, IntPtrConstant(1))); in StoreOrderedHashSetNewEntry() 2099 return IntPtrSub(capacity, IntPtrConstant(1)); in EntryMask() 2196 TNode<IntPtrT> available = IntPtrSub(capacity, number_of_elements); in InsufficientCapacityToAdd()
|
D | builtins-internal-gen.cc | 150 TimesPointerSize(IntPtrSub(offset, index)))); in TF_BUILTIN()
|
D | base.tq | 274 extern operator '-' macro IntPtrSub(intptr, intptr): intptr;
|
D | builtins-typed-array-gen.cc | 1345 IntPtrSub(source_byte_length, source_start_bytes); in TF_BUILTIN()
|
D | builtins-array-gen.cc | 971 Node* new_length = IntPtrSub(length, IntPtrConstant(1)); in TF_BUILTIN() 1542 Node* new_length = IntPtrSub(length, IntPtrConstant(1)); in TF_BUILTIN()
|
D | builtins-promise-gen.cc | 2093 TNode<IntPtrT> index = IntPtrSub(identity_hash, IntPtrConstant(1)); in TF_BUILTIN()
|
/external/v8/src/ |
D | code-stub-assembler.cc | 340 value = Signed(IntPtrSub(value, IntPtrConstant(1))); in IntPtrRoundUpToPowerOfTwo32() 361 [=] { return WordAnd(value, IntPtrSub(value, IntPtrConstant(1))); }), in WordIsPowerOfTwo() 1415 return Load(rep, object, IntPtrSub(offset, IntPtrConstant(kHeapObjectTag))); in LoadObjectField() 2062 Unsigned(IntPtrSub(IntPtrConstant(0), value))); in LoadFixedBigInt64ArrayElementAsTagged() 2101 var_high = IntPtrSub(IntPtrConstant(0), var_high.value()); in LoadFixedBigInt64ArrayElementAsTagged() 2105 var_high = IntPtrSub(var_high.value(), IntPtrConstant(1)); in LoadFixedBigInt64ArrayElementAsTagged() 2108 var_low = IntPtrSub(IntPtrConstant(0), var_low.value()); in LoadFixedBigInt64ArrayElementAsTagged() 2682 return Store(object, IntPtrSub(offset, IntPtrConstant(kHeapObjectTag)), in StoreObjectField() 2699 rep, object, IntPtrSub(offset, IntPtrConstant(kHeapObjectTag)), value); in StoreObjectFieldNoWriteBarrier() 2899 IntPtrSub(UncheckedCast<IntPtrT>(args->GetLength(INTPTR_PARAMETERS)), in BuildAppendJSArray() [all …]
|
D | code-stub-assembler.h | 419 PARAMETER_BINOP(IntPtrOrSmiSub, IntPtrSub, SmiSub) 525 SMI_ARITHMETIC_BINOP(SmiSub, IntPtrSub, Int32Sub) in SMI_ARITHMETIC_BINOP()
|
/external/v8/src/compiler/ |
D | code-assembler.h | 910 TNode<WordT> IntPtrSub(SloppyTNode<WordT> left, SloppyTNode<WordT> right); 916 TNode<IntPtrT> IntPtrSub(TNode<IntPtrT> left, TNode<IntPtrT> right) { 918 IntPtrSub(static_cast<Node*>(left), static_cast<Node*>(right)));
|
D | code-assembler.cc | 516 TNode<WordT> CodeAssembler::IntPtrSub(SloppyTNode<WordT> left, in IntPtrSub() function in v8::internal::compiler::CodeAssembler 531 return UncheckedCast<IntPtrT>(raw_assembler()->IntPtrSub(left, right)); in IntPtrSub()
|
/external/v8/src/ic/ |
D | accessor-assembler.cc | 1155 IntPtrSub(field_index, instance_size_in_words); in OverwriteExistingFastDataProperty() 3490 TimesPointerSize(IntPtrSub(result_start, source_start)); in GenerateCloneObjectIC()
|